cfq-iosched: idling on deep seeky sync queues
Seeky sync queues with large depth can gain unfairly big share of disk time, at the expense of other seeky queues. This patch ensures that idling will be enabled for queues with I/O depth at least 4, and small think time. The decision to enable idling is sticky, until an idle window times out without seeing a new request. The reasoning behind the decision is that, if an application is using large I/O depth, it is already optimized to make full utilization of the hardware, and therefore we reserve a slice of exclusive use for it.
